76 %description
77 The glibc package contains standard libraries which are used by
78 multiple programs on the system. In order to save disk space and
79 memory, as well as to make upgrading easier, common system code is
80 kept in one place and shared between programs. This particular package
81 contains the most important sets of shared libraries: the standard C
82 library and the standard math library. Without these two libraries, a
83 Linux system will not function.

166 %description utils
167 The glibc-utils package contains memusage, a memory usage profiler,
168 mtrace, a memory leak tracer and xtrace, a function call tracer
169 which can be helpful during program debugging.
171 If unsure if you need this, don't install this package.
